Choosing the Right Materials
One of the most critical aspects of patio design is selecting the right materials. In patio design Anne Auburn County, the choice of materials can significantly impact the look and durability of your outdoor space.
- Concrete is a popular option for solid, long-lasting patios. It comes in various textures and colors, allowing for a personalized touch. You can pair it with gravel or mulch for added depth.
- Wood brings warmth and natural beauty. Cedar or redwood are excellent choices, especially if you want a cozy, earthy vibe.
- Stone adds a touch of sophistication and resilience. It’s ideal for areas exposed to rain or heavy foot traffic.
- Metal finishes offer a sleek, modern aesthetic. They can be paired with glass or stone for a contemporary look.
When choosing materials, consider the local weather conditions. Anne Auburn County experiences a mix of sun and rain, so selecting weather-resistant options is essential. Also, think about the durability of your materials - some last longer than others, which can affect your long-term investment.
Layout and Space Planning
A well-planned layout is the backbone of any successful patio design. In Anne Auburn County, the way you arrange your space can influence how comfortable and inviting it feels.
Start by assessing the size of your yard. Measure the dimensions carefully, as this will guide your decisions on furniture placement and plant selection. Aim for a balance between open space and defined areas. For example, a central seating area surrounded by lush greenery can create a serene atmosphere.
Consider the flow of movement around your patio. Avoid cluttering pathways with too many items, as this can make the space feel cramped. Instead, arrange furniture in clusters or lines that lead naturally to seating areas. Adding mirrors can also help expand the perceived space.
Don’t forget to leave room for ventilation and accessibility. A patio that’s too enclosed can feel stifling, especially in warmer months. Incorporating open sections allows for better air circulation and a more relaxed vibe.

Lighting Solutions for Your Patio
Lighting is a game-changer in patio design. It can define spaces, highlight features, and create ambiance. In anne Auburn County, where the sun sets beautifully, thoughtful lighting can make your patio shine even brighter.
Consider installing solar-powered lights for a sustainable option. Solar lights are energy-efficient and come in a variety of styles, from sleek to decorative. They’re perfect for outlining pathways or adding character to your seating area.
If you’re looking for a more dramatic effect, string lights wrapped around trees or pillars can create a magical glow. For a cozy atmosphere, battery-operated lanterns placed throughout the space can provide soft, warm lighting.
Don’t forget about the importance of consistency. Use similar light colors and styles throughout your patio to maintain a cohesive look. This helps your space feel more unified and inviting.
Plants and Greenery
Adding plants to your patio is a great way to enhance its beauty and bring life to your space. In patio design Anne Auburn County, the right plants can transform a simple area into a lush retreat.
Choose native species that thrive in the local climate. These plants require less maintenance and are more resilient to weather changes. Some popular options include succulents, ferns, and flowering perennials that bloom throughout the seasons.
Incorporate vertical elements like trellises or wall planters to maximize space. These features not only add visual interest but also make your patio feel larger.
Water features, such as a small fountain or pond, can also enhance the atmosphere. The sounds of water create a calming effect, making your patio a perfect spot for relaxation.
